Travel Tips Of Mahanandi
Tourism Tips
Health & Safety: The temple floor can be slippery; walk carefully near the water tanks.
Packing: Carry a fresh set of clothes if you plan to take a holy dip in the tank.
Accommodation: Several "Chatrams" (rest houses) and hotels are available in Mahanandi and Nandyal town.
Dress Code: Traditional attire like dhotis for men and sarees for women is preferred for inner sanctum entry.
